SaverOne 2014 Ltd.

SaverOne 2014 Ltd. was founded in 2014 and is headquartered in Petah Tikva, Israel. Noam Dayan serves as Chairman and Ori Gilboa as CEO; the company completed an initial public offering on the Tel Aviv Stock Exchange in 2021 (per public record). SaverOne’s technology detects a driver's smartphone in the vehicle cabin and restricts non-navigation apps while the vehicle is in motion, aiming to reduce accident rates linked to distracted driving. The company targets the commercial fleet and insurance markets, deploying its system as a hardware unit combined with a mobile app. Reported early-adopter programs include logistics companies and insurance pilot programs in Israel (per public record). SaverOne's geographic focus remains primarily domestic, though it has stated intentions to expand into European and North American markets (per the firm's public communications). Its revenue model is a mix of device sales and recurring software subscriptions. As of mid-2024, SaverOne reported roughly $1.2 million in annual revenue and a market capitalization below $10 million (public record). The company cited regulatory tailwinds from new distracted-driving laws in several US states and EU member states. No recent major deployment numbers or team-size updates are publicly available. SaverOne’s structural differentiator lies in its hardware-plus-software approach — it is an industrial-safety firm rather than a pure-play app developer. Its status as a publicly traded small-cap provides transparency into its financials, but the company remains pre-profit and faces execution risk scaling beyond Israel.
